Let R be an equivalence relation on a finite set A having n elements. Then, the number of ordered pairs in R is

  1. Less than n  
  2. Greater than or equal to n  
  3. Less than or equal to n  
  4. None of these  

The correct answer is: Greater than or equal to n


    Since R is an equivalence relation on set A. Therefore left parenthesis a comma a right parenthesis element of R for all a element of A.
    Hence, R has at least n ordered pairs
